
Good Laboratory Practices (GLP)
Good Laboratory Practices (GLP) are a set of guidelines designed to ensure the quality and integrity of non-clinical laboratory studies, particularly those related to pharmaceuticals, chemicals, and other products. GLP establishes standards for how research is conducted, including proper documentation, equipment maintenance, and staff training. These practices help guarantee that results are valid and can be trusted by regulatory bodies, which is essential for safety assessments and product approvals. By following GLP, laboratories can ensure that their findings are reliable and that they adhere to ethical and professional standards.
